Gastric sleeve surgery, also known as sleeve gastrectomy, is one of the most commonly performed weight loss procedures in Australia. While it can be life-changing for individuals struggling with obesity, understanding the financial commitment is crucial before proceeding.

The gastric sleeve surgery cost on the Gold Coast can vary significantly depending on several key factors. Here’s a closer look at what influences the total cost of this procedure.

Surgeon’s Experience and Reputation

One of the biggest determinants of cost is the surgeon you choose. Highly experienced bariatric surgeons often charge more due to their proven track records, specialised training, and lower complication rates. However, this often translates into better outcomes and greater peace of mind for patients. Don’t just shop for the lowest price—balance cost with qualifications and patient reviews.

Hospital and Facility Fees

Where your surgery is performed also affects the total cost. Procedures carried out in private hospitals or premium surgical centres tend to incur higher fees due to advanced technology, superior facilities, and enhanced patient services. These fees typically cover the operating theatre, nursing care, hospital stay, and general amenities.

Type of Health Cover or Insurance

Private health insurance can significantly reduce your out-of-pocket expenses, depending on your level of cover. Policies vary, so it’s essential to check whether bariatric surgery is included, what portion is covered, and if there are any waiting periods. Those without insurance may need to fund the full cost themselves, which can make the procedure substantially more expensive.

Inclusions in the Surgical Package

Some clinics offer comprehensive packages that cover not only the surgery but also pre-operative consultations, post-operative care, dietitian support, and follow-up appointments. While these packages may appear more expensive upfront, they often offer better value in the long run by reducing the need for additional out-of-pocket expenses.

Additional Medical Requirements

Costs can also rise if you require additional medical assessments before surgery, such as blood tests, endoscopy, or cardiac clearance. Similarly, patients with complex medical histories may require more intensive monitoring or longer hospital stays, which can increase the overall cost.

Aftercare and Support Services

Ongoing support after surgery is critical to long-term success. Some clinics include access to dietitians, psychologists, and support groups in their pricing. Others charge separately for these services, so it’s important to clarify what’s included before making a decision.
